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ature Mehrer Meter
Definition Person, die eine größere Menge von etwas anhäuft SI-Basiseinheit für die Länge; eine Strecke, die das Licht im Vakuum in 1/299.792.458 Sekunden zurücklegt

Why the eye confuses Mehrer with Meter

A purely visual mix-up. Mehrer ([ˈmeːʁɐ]) and Meter ([ˈmeːtɐ]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they differ by 1 letter(s) in length. Our composite confusion score for this pair is 42738, derived from the frequency rank of both members and their visual similarity.

Mehrer is recorded at frequency rank #41,985, classified as anoun, pronounced [ˈmeːʁɐ]. Meter is at rank #753, tagged as anoun, pronounced [ˈmeːtɐ].

Frequently Asked Questions

Can "Mehrer" and "Meter" be used interchangeably?
No. They are said differently ([ˈmeːʁɐ] versus [ˈmeːtɐ]) and carry different meanings; reading the sentence aloud is usually enough to catch the wrong one.
Which is more common, "Mehrer" or "Meter"?
"Meter" is the more common of the two: it sits at frequency rank #753 in our German list, against #41,985 for "Mehrer". That is a wide gap, so in ordinary text the rarer spelling is the one worth double-checking.
